ELIZABETH CITY, NC - The Elizabeth City State basketball team (1-2) would cruise past the Mustangs of Mid-Atlantic Christian (0-5) on Wednesday evening at the R.L. Vaughan Center.
The Vikings would be led by freshman
Xavier Tubbs-Matthews and Sophomore
Jaquantae Harris. Tubbs-Matthews would lead all scorers with 15, Harris would add 14 shooting 71% from the field.
Reggie Raynor would play big down the stretch accumulating numerous blocks and be on the receiving end of two beautiful alley-oops.
The Vikings would cruise and make it to the century mark on the scoreboard.
The Vikings return to action as they will play Mount Olive and Barton College this weekend in the annual pickle Classic hosted at Mount Olive University.
